What happened
Substack is partnering with Pangram to add an AI detection feature, according to Engadget. The partnership will bring Pangram's AI-content-detection technology to the newsletter platform, though the initial reporting does not specify exactly how the feature will be surfaced to readers, writers, or editors.
Pangram is a company focused on detecting AI-generated text. By integrating its detection capabilities, Substack appears to be responding to a broader industry concern: as generative AI tools make it cheap and fast to produce large volumes of plausible-sounding prose, platforms that host written content face growing questions about transparency, quality, and trust.
Why it matters
Newsletter platforms like Substack occupy a unique position in the media ecosystem. They rely on a direct relationship between writers and paying subscribers, and that relationship depends heavily on the assumption that readers know what — and whom — they are reading. If AI-generated content floods the platform without disclosure, subscriber trust could erode.
AI detection remains an imperfect science. Detectors can produce false positives — flagging human writing as AI-generated — and false negatives, missing AI text that has been lightly edited or paraphrased. Any platform deploying detection at scale will need to decide how labels are applied, whether writers can appeal, and whether detection results are shown to readers, editors, or both. The Engadget report does not yet address these questions, so it remains unclear what the user-facing experience will look like.
For writers, the introduction of detection raises practical concerns. A false positive could damage a writer's reputation or subscriber base. For readers, the value depends on whether the feature is informative rather than punitive.
